    Aerial Insulated Cables

    Product code
    1. Series code JK: Aerial insulated cable
    2. Conductor material code
    L: Aluminum conductor LH: Aluminum alloy conductor LG: Steel core aluminum stranded wire conductor TR: Soft copper conductor
    3. Insulation material code V: polyvinyl chloride (PVC) insulation Y: polyethylene insulation or high-density polyethylene insulation YJ: cross-linked polyethylene (XLPE) insulation
    /B: Natural insulation
    /Q: Lightweight thin insulation structure

    Product Usage:
    Aerial insulated wire is a wire with a single or multiple layers of aluminum stranded wire twisted on top of which an insulation layer is extruded.
    The so-called overhead line is relative to the cable, which refers to a line where the conductors are erected by towers at a certain height to transmit electrical energy. For high-voltage power transmission and distribution network overhead lines, the ground insulation is generally relying on air. Previously, bare conductors were also commonly used for distribution lines (except for 380V below 10kV). However, due to the complex distribution environment in urban areas, short circuit grounding and lightning strikes often occur on the lines, resulting in a decrease in power supply reliability. Therefore, currently, insulated conductors (i.e. insulated layers wrapped around the outer layer of the conductors) are generally used for overhead lines below 10kV, which is known as insulated overhead lines.

    Steel core aluminum stranded wire is a reinforced conductor made by twisting single-layer or multi-layer aluminum strands outside galvanized steel core wire.
    Steel core aluminum stranded wire is made by twisting aluminum wire and steel wire, suitable for overhead transmission lines. It has a steel core inside and aluminum wires wrapped around the steel core through twisting on the outside; The steel core mainly serves to increase strength, while the aluminum stranded wire mainly serves to transmit electrical energy.
    Steel core aluminum stranded wire has the characteristics of simple structure, easy installation and maintenance, low line cost, large transmission capacity, and is conducive to laying under special geographical conditions such as crossing rivers and valleys. It also has good conductivity and sufficient mechanical strength, high tensile strength, and can be enlarged for tower distance. Therefore, it is widely used in various voltage levels of overhead transmission and distribution lines.
